BASIC OPERATION

PWR ON Password

 If the transceiver is set with a power ON password, 
enter the password when turning ON the transceiver. 
To enter the password, see the illustration below.

The password is a 4 digit code (example: 1234).

 

Push the corresponding keys to enter your password.

  •  Note that each key represents two digits. That means, 

“3764” and “8769” are entered in exactly the same way 
(requires no multiple or extended pushing.) 

  •  The entered password will not be displayed.
  •  If “PASSWD” does not disappear after entering, the 

entered password is incorrect. Turn OFF the transceiver, 
and then try again.

 There are 80 UHF CB channels and you have access 
to all 80 channels, including designated repeater chan-
nels. You can select between them to communicate with 
a specific person(s). The IC-41PRO is also capable of 
being set with an additional 35 receive only channels, 
using the optional 

cs-41PrO 

clOning

 

sOftware

.

 

 Rotate [ROTARY SELECTOR] to scroll through the 
selectable channels.
